Never Mind The Spiritual Cramps

A couple of months ago, my friend Sarah had messaged me, asking if I could find her a limited record that she was interesting in buying. Easy enough task for someone like me that is always on the hunt for records, and within minutes I was sending her a discogs link for where she could buy it. I thought the price was reasonable, but for someone that doesn't collect records, the $50 price tag may have seemed a bit high. She ended up buying the record and then I got to talking about some expensive records that I had sitting in my Discogs cart that I've been hesitant to pull the trigger on... and after talking her into buying a record, I felt like it was time to treat myself as well.
I've been obsessed with Spiritual Cramp since discovering them early this year. I really like this band, but I was a bit on the fence on how much I really wanted to collect their records. I'd been keeping my eye on the record release version for the first 7 inch for a while, and wringing my hands over if I should spend the money or not. It was released by REACT Records, and since I have a decent REACT collection, that made me want it a bit more... plus that Sex Pistols cover design and the fact that only 35 of them existed, really helped to force my hand. Fuck. If I didn't buy it, who knows if I would ever get the chance again... so while I was riding that Spiritual Cramp high, I clicked the button on Discogs to order it.
The copy that I received had a note inside to the original buyer, and I assume from the singer, Mike. Thanks for the five bucks bro.
Number 27 of 35.
